Stad Ship Tunnel

The Stad Skip Tunnel ( German " Stad Ship Tunnel" ) is an in- vessel tunnel planning in the West Norwegian Selje Fylke in Sogn og Fjordane, which is to traverse the Stadlandet. The tunnel will connect the Molde Fjord Eide with the Vanylvsfjord at Kjøde. The planned size of the building amounted to a height of 33 m, a width of 23 m and a length of 1.7 km; the water depth would be at 12 m. Thus, the ship tunnel would be large enough to allow the ships of the Hurtigruten passage. The construction costs are estimated at 1.7 billion Norwegian kroner.

The building is expected passage of the sea arm Stadthavet, which is considered very rough due to the cross lakes, are avoided.
